What is the Amazon Kindle Select program?

Amazon Kindle Select program is one of the ebook marketing programs on Amazon where published authors on Amazon Kindle Direct Publishing (KDP) can enroll their books to enjoy exclusive extra promotional push from Amazon.

Authors can enroll their books in this program during the publication of their books on Amazon kDP. They can also do this after their book is already published.

This implies that old published books can be enrolled in the program at any time. Though, for any book to qualify to be enrolled in this program, it must not be available for sale as an ebook on any other online store as an ebook.

Therefore, if you intend to enroll your ebook in the Amazon Select program, you must, first of all, unpublish the ebook version on any other online stores like Apple, Kobo, or Barnes and Noble.

How we use the Amazon Kindle Select program

We have used the Amazon Kindle Select program to boost the visibility of our ebooks on Amazon. The following will show you how we have done that over the years:

Enrolling all new ebooks

We always get our new ebooks published first on Amazon. While we publish the eBooks, we get them enrolled in the Kindle Select program. Since it’s a new ebook, it has not been published anywhere else so it’s qualify to be in the Kindle Select program.

Schedule first free days

After Amazon’s approval and the ebook comes live on Amazon, we schedule the first free days in the Kindle Select program.

In the Kindle Select program, Amazon allows authors to make their ebooks free for their paid subscription readers for a maximum of five days in a three-month cycle.

We always schedule the first three days out of the five allowed days.

Publicize on Facebook and others

We will then announce the free day periods in our newsletter dedicated to Amazon readers and also on Facebook groups where Kindle ebooks are given out free.

Publicize on book promotion websites

Sometimes, we also announce our Kindle Select program free days on book promotion websites. These websites have both free and paid versions.

Analyze the response

After the free days, we analyze the response of readers to our free ebook. Usually, we get some downloads on Amazon and this is reflected in your Amazon KDP Dashboard.

New readers and new KENP reads

Usually, some of these new readers go on to read this new ebook and this counts into our Kindle Edition Normalized Pages read (KENP). Amazon pays monthly for these reads depending on a lot of factors.

New readers and new reviews

The most important benefits of enrolling our ebooks on the Kindle Select program and getting new readers are the new reviews we get from these free readers and also the boost it gives to the new ebook on Amazon search.

The Kindle Select program offers lots of great benefits for your ebooks sales on Amazon. You can always take your ebooks out of the program after the initial three months. You can also allow it to auto-renew.

We usually take out some ebooks from the program to publish them on other online stores. But we always have ebooks available in the Kindle Select program.
